1. Serial Killer James Fairweather
After brutally killing two strangers, James Fairweather was given a sentence in 2016 that included a minimum of 27 years in jail.
Fairweather claims that his obsession with serial killers, particularly his favorite, Ted Bundy, served as the motivation for the killings.
When intoxicated and resting in a park, his first victim was stabbed 102 times to death, while his second was slain with a bayonet.
After the trial, Fairweather’s mother said, “James Fairweather is a monster in our eyes – and we will never be able to forgive him.”
2. Charles Starkweather
Have you seen the motion picture “Natural Born Killers”? The real-life relationship between Charles Starkweather and his 14-year-old lover, Caril Ann Fugate, served as the basis for the tale.
They embarked on a two-month killing rampage after killing Fugate’s mother, stepfather, and two-year-old sister.
11 persons had already passed away by the time they were captured. Fugate served 17 years in prison before being released, while Starkweather received an electric chair death sentence.
3. Mary Bell – 11 years old
Mary Bell, who wasn’t nearly a teenager, worked with her best friend, Norma Bell, 13, who was unrelated despite sharing the same last name.
The two youngsters, who were three and four years old, were both strangled by the pair.
When the police looked into Mary’s background, they discovered that her mother was a prostitute and had been abusive.
She attempted to kill Mary on several occasions and coerced Mary into having sex with males.
While Norma was acquitted of the crimes on account of her feeble-mindedness, Mary served 12 years in a juvenile detention center.
Today, she’s a grandmother and lives anonymously under a new name.
4. William Heirens – 18 years old
William Heirens began committing petty crimes at the age of 13, but, five years later, he turned to murder. After brutally stabbing his second female victim, he wrote a message on the wall in lipstick.
It read, “For heaven’s sake, catch me before I kill more. I cannot control myself.”
Sadly, he would murder a six-year-old girl before the police finally caught him.
Heirens served 65 years in a Chicago prison before dying of natural causes.

5. Jesse Pomeroy – 14 years old

Jesse Pomeroy’s case is notorious since he was one of the country’s first recognized teenage serial killers.
When Pomeroy was 12 years old, he started killing young boys in Massachusetts.
He resumed his murdering spree after his family relocated to South Boston.
He was caught by authorities and only spent two years in a juvenile correctional facility.
Pomeroy was given his parole at the age of 14 and went back to live with his mother.
But a short while later, he was held responsible for the deaths of two more kids.
He was later moved to the Bridgewater Hospital for the Criminally Insane after receiving a life sentence.
